Sign in to your ScreenRant account Few comic characters have costumes as immediately recognizable as Marvel's Punisher - one look at that giant skull and comic fans and NYC criminals alike know there's about to be a blood bath. Now, Marvel is doing something new with the iconic look. Punisher has a lot of uses for his costume, from psyching out his dangerous prey to focusing their fire on his reinforced chest armor. However, sometimes tactical necessity dictates a new look... That's the case as the upcoming Punisher #12 sees Frank Castle hunting criminals through an unprecedented blizzard, switching to a white costume as vital camouflage on an unexpected mission... Punisher Gets All-White Costume for a Snow Mission Marvel has revealed a new all-white costume for the Punisher designed by acclaimed artist Declan Shalvey. The costume will debut in the upcoming Punisher #12, coming from Benjamin Percy and Declan Shalvey on December 23. The new outfit was revealed exclusively by CBR, and includes a black skull logo, intended for a snowbound mission by lethal vigilate Frank Castle. Cover art by David Marquez and Shalvey show Punisher trudging through the snow and riding a snowmobile through the New York streets, with camoflaged white weaponry and a high collar to protect him from the elements. Of course, Frank Castle's skull isn't just practical - it's also a statement of purpose, and so despite the snow camo, the Punisher is emblazoning his new costume with a gigantic black skull. Seeing Shalvey back on art duties is a treat, given his acclaimed record on series including Wolverine, Moon Knight and Mystique. The Punisher #12 is coming December 23 from Marvel Comics.
